    Step-by-Step Safety Guide

    Begin by washing your hands thoroughly with soap and warm water for at least twenty seconds before handling any food ingredients. This simple act removes bacteria that may have transferred from surfaces, pets, or raw meats. Next, inspect all ingredients, particularly eggs and dairy, for freshness. If you are using raw eggs in homemade noodle dough or sauces, consider using pasteurized eggs to eliminate the risk entirely. Always check expiration dates and discard any items that appear spoiled or have an unusual odor.

    When cooking, use a food thermometer to verify that the internal temperature of your dish reaches 165°F (74°C). This temperature is critical for killing salmonella bacteria effectively. Do not rely on visual cues alone, as bacteria may not change the appearance or taste of the food. Ensure that any meat, poultry, or seafood added to your noodles is cooked separately before being combined with the noodles to guarantee even heating.

    Avoid cross-contamination by keeping raw meats and ready-to-eat foods separate. Use different cutting boards and knives for raw ingredients and vegetables. If you must use the same surfaces, wash them thoroughly with hot, soapy water between uses. Never place cooked noodles on a plate that previously held raw meat or eggs without washing the plate first. This step is crucial for preventing the transfer of bacteria from one food item to another.

    Store leftovers promptly in shallow containers in the refrigerator within two hours of cooking. Proper cooling prevents bacteria from multiplying rapidly. When reheating, ensure the noodles are steaming hot throughout. Avoid leaving cooked noodles at room temperature for extended periods, as this creates an ideal environment for bacterial growth.     Running with flat feet, or pes planus, presents unique challenges that can lead to discomfort, injury, and inefficient biomechanics if not addressed properly. The primary issue is overpronation, where the foot rolls inward excessively upon impact, placing undue stress on the knees, hips, and lower back. Therefore, selecting the right footwear is not merely a matter of comfort but a critical component of injury prevention and performance optimization. When navigating the vast market of athletic footwear, it is essential to understand the specific engineering required to support a collapsed arch structure effectively.

    If you want to dig deeper, check out our guide on Why the Smartest AI Model Is a Terrible Business Move.

    Key Features to Look For

    The most important feature in a shoe for flat feet is stability. Unlike neutral shoes that offer minimal guidance, stability shoes are designed with dual-density midsoles. The inner side, known as the medial post, is made of firmer foam to resist compression and prevent the foot from rolling inward. Additionally, look for a wide base and a structured heel counter. A firm heel cup locks the rear foot in place, providing a solid foundation for the stride. Motion control shoes are another option for severe overpronators, offering maximum support through rigid materials and extended guiding rails. However, these can feel heavy, so finding the right balance between support and flexibility is crucial for long-distance runners.

    Comparing Top Contenders

    Among the leading options, the Brooks Adrenaline GTS stands out for its GuideRails technology. Unlike traditional posts that only support the arch, GuideRails keep the knees aligned by limiting excessive motion without feeling intrusive. This makes it an excellent choice for runners who want support without a bulky feel. On the other hand, the ASICS Gel-Kayano offers a more traditional stability experience with its FF TRUSSTIC technology and ample cushioning. It is ideal for those who prioritize plush comfort alongside firm support. For runners seeking a lighter option, the Hoka One One Arahi provides a meta-rocker sole that promotes a smooth transition from heel to toe, reducing strain on the lower limbs. While these models vary in price and weight, they all address the core need for arch support and pronation control.

  • How to Fix a Leaky Faucet: Step-by-Step Plumbing Tutorial

    How to Fix a Leaky Faucet: Step-by-Step Plumbing Tutorial

    TL;DR: To fix a leaky faucet, turn off the water supply, disassemble the handle, replace the worn washer or cartridge, and reassemble the components. This simple repair saves money and prevents water waste.

    A dripping faucet is more than just a minor annoyance; it can waste gallons of water daily and increase your utility bills significantly. Fortunately, most leaks are caused by simple wear and tear on internal components like washers, O-rings, or cartridges. By following a systematic approach, you can restore your faucet to perfect working order without calling a professional plumber. This guide will walk you through the essential steps to diagnose and repair common faucet leaks effectively.

    If you want to dig deeper, check out our guide on China’s New Bullet Train: 0 to 800km/h in 5 Seconds.

    Prepare Your Workspace

    Before touching any tools, ensure you have the necessary items ready. You will need an adjustable wrench, screwdrivers (both flathead and Phillips), pliers, and a replacement kit specific to your faucet type. Most hardware stores carry universal repair kits, but it is best to bring an old washer or cartridge to the store for an exact match. Clear the area under the sink and place a towel or bucket to catch any residual water. This preparation prevents messes and ensures you do not lose small parts down the drain.

    Shut Off the Water

    Safety and cleanliness are paramount. Locate the shut-off valves under the sink and turn them clockwise until they are tight. If there are no individual valves, you may need to shut off the main water supply to your house. Once the water is off, open the faucet to release any remaining pressure and water in the lines. This step is crucial to prevent spraying water when you disassemble the faucet components.

    Disassemble the Faucet

    Start by removing the decorative cap on the faucet handle, usually found on top. Use a small screwdriver or knife to gently pry it off. Underneath, you will find a screw securing the handle. Remove this screw and lift the handle off. If the handle is stuck, use pliers gently to wiggle it free. Depending on your faucet type, you may need to remove a retaining nut or clip next. Keep track of every screw and part, laying them out in order on your towel. This organization makes reassembly much easier and less confusing.

    Replace Faulty Parts

    Inspect the internal components for signs of wear. In compression faucets, look for the rubber washer at the bottom of the stem. If it is cracked, flattened, or eroded, replace it with a new one. For cartridge or ball-type faucets, inspect the O-rings and seals. Lubricate new O-rings with plumber’s grease before installing them. Ensure the new parts fit snugly and correctly. Do not force any components, as this can damage the faucet body. Take photos during disassembly to help guide you during reassembly.

    Reassemble and Test

    Reverse the disassembly steps to put everything back together. Tighten all screws and nuts securely but do not overtighten, as this can strip threads or crack plastic parts. Once reassembled, turn the water supply back on slowly. Check for leaks around the base and handle. If water drips, tighten connections slightly. If the leak persists, recheck your seals and ensure they are seated properly. A well-sealed faucet should operate smoothly without any dripping.

    The Science of Freezing Zucchini

    Freezing is the most effective method for long-term preservation, but it requires a specific technique to maintain quality. Simply tossing raw zucchini into the freezer often results in a slimy, unappetizing mess when thawed. This is because the water inside the vegetable expands and forms ice crystals that puncture cell walls. When thawed, the structural support collapses, releasing all that water. To combat this, blanching is essential. Blanching involves briefly boiling the zucchini slices and then plunging them into an ice bath. This process deactivates enzymes that cause loss of flavor, color, and texture. It also sterilizes the surface, reducing bacterial load.

    Once blanched and dried, the zucchini can be spread on a baking sheet to freeze individually before being transferred to airtight freezer bags. This “flash freezing” prevents the pieces from sticking together, allowing you to grab only what you need. Frozen zucchini is perfect for smoothies, soups, stews, and baked goods like breads and muffins. While it may not hold its shape for a stir-fry, its nutritional profile remains largely intact. Vitamins such as vitamin C and potassium are preserved well through the blanching and freezing process, ensuring you still get the health benefits of this low-calorie, nutrient-dense vegetable.
